Marqt is a Dutch food retail concept that offers sustainable, real food to its customers. Marqt distinguishes itself by sourcing products that are local, minimally processed and produced with respect for people, animals and the environment. Products range from fresh sustainably caught fish presented on crushed ice, locally grown fruits and vegetables, a delicious selection of breads baked daily on the premises, organic meat and dairy products, including organic artisanal farmer cheeses. Founded in 2008 by Quirijn Bolle, Marqt operates, as of July 2016, 15 stores in the Greater Amsterdam area, Rotterdam, Haarlem and Den Haag, ranging in size from 600m2 to 1000m2 and plans to open further stores in The Netherlands. As part of our focus on health and wellness, Verlinvest became a minority investor in Marqt in 2011. Verlinvest disposed of its stake in Marqt in May 2017.
